Output 81e521e268c0a5773001d80de0df22a0bb83d378ab8a66fada4376e250bee722:2

value
299900000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7d621636628e50ea28a0c63ed7bd5f6db0efb9aa OP_EQUAL
address
MKL8Cban39HC1aRn7ZfWzCKkqWs4JWemy6
transaction
81e521e268c0a5773001d80de0df22a0bb83d378ab8a66fada4376e250bee722
spent
true